Amy Winehouse wanted to have a child with her ex-husband Blake Fielder-Civil, according to his mother Georgette.

Blake is currently in jail in Leeds on charges of burglary and fake gun possession, but his mom says that he showed her letters from Winehouse before he started serving his sentence.

"The letters show Amy was totally in love with Blake," she says. "She was besotted. She called Blake her proudest achievement."

Amy and Blake met in 2005 and were married in 2007. But two years later they split. The letters seem to indicate that Winehouse never really let him go.

"In one letter Amy wrote that Blake was definitely getting her pregnant within two months," Georgette says. "She talked about conceiving the baby — which they would call Lucky — on Valentine’s Day."

The pair communicated despite their divorce.

"Even after their divorce Amy told Blake she’d love him forever," Georgette said. "They carried on talking to each other until a few months before she died."

Georgette guessed that the last letter he'd received from her was in March of 2010, so that's a little more than "a few months," but still, she says Winehouse closed each correspondence with "Your Wife."
